Question to the Department for Business, Energy and Industrial Strategy:

To ask the Secretary of State for Business, Energy and Industrial Strategy, how many contracts procured by his Department and its arms-length bodies are covered by TUPE regulations in each of the last three financial years.

The Department does not hold details of the number of contracts covered by TUPE Regulations and information is not held on this matter for the Department’s arms-length bodies.

Contracts are created using standard terms and conditions which generally contain clauses that relate to TUPE and, amongst other things, place obligations on the supplier to provide information and to cooperate with the Department during any transfer of services.
